Skip to content

Instantly share code, notes, and snippets.

View jmerle's full-sized avatar
🇳🇱

Jasper van Merle jmerle

🇳🇱
View GitHub Profile
@jmerle
jmerle / HETools_Helper_Install.user.js
Last active July 9, 2016 14:11
HETools Helper Install
// ==UserScript==
// @name HETools Helper
// @version 1.0.0
// @description A small script that enables you to sync your Hacker Experience HDB with HETools
// @author Jasper van Merle (Jasperr)
// @match https://*.hackerexperience.com/list*
// ==/UserScript==
$.getScript("https://cdn.rawgit.com/JvanMerle/60bd611423bc518426c3a8cf690a33e5/raw/090b55bc333587c7af2751318e4c4020659bce2e/HETools_Helper_Script.js");
@jmerle
jmerle / HETools_Helper_Script.js
Last active July 9, 2016 14:10
HETools Helper Script
/* Variables */
var gritterLoaded = false;
var footer = document.getElementsByClassName("pagination alternate")[0];
var liTags = footer.getElementsByTagName("li");
var numberOfPages = parseInt(liTags[liTags.length - 2].innerText);
var currentWebsiteURL = window.location.protocol + "//" + window.location.hostname;
var savedDatabase = document.getElementById("list").innerHTML;
/* Functions */
function gritterNotify(opts) {